SEW-EURODRIVE MC2RLHF03: Bevel-Helical Speed Reducer Technical Guide
The SEW-EURODRIVE MC (Modular Compact) series is a premier line of industrial gear units designed to bridge the gap between standard geared motors and massive, custom-engineered drives. The MC2RLHF03 is a high-performance, right-angle bevel-helical gearbox engineered for applications demanding high torque, space efficiency, and robust mechanical reliability.
Below is a detailed breakdown of the unit’s specifications, design features, and essential manual-based maintenance guidelines.
1. Decoding the Model: MC2RLHF03
To understand the specific capabilities of this unit, we must analyze the SEW nomenclature:
- MC (Series): Modular Compact industrial gear unit.
- 2 (Stages): A two-stage reduction system. This configuration offers high mechanical efficiency (typically 95%–97%) while providing a wide range of ratios for speed reduction.
- R (Type): Bevel-helical (Right-angle) design. The input and output shafts are at a 90° angle, allowing the motor to sit parallel to the machine frame.
- L (Mounting): Horizontal mounting position.
- H (Shaft): Hollow shaft design. This allows the gearbox to be mounted directly onto the driven machine's shaft.
- F (Mounting Style): Flange-mounted (B5 flange). Ideal for securing the unit directly to a machine wall or mixing vat.
- 03 (Size): Frame size 03. This size typically handles nominal output torques between 6,000 Nm and 10,000 Nm, depending on the service factor and ratio.
2. Key Design Advantages
The MC2RLHF03 is built for longevity in harsh industrial environments like mining, cement, and chemical processing.
High Power Density
The "Compact" in MC refers to its ability to deliver massive torque without a massive footprint. By using case-hardened, high-strength steel gears and a rigid monoblock housing, SEW provides a unit that fits into tight spaces where traditional gearboxes might fail.
Smooth Power Transmission
The combination of helical gears (for the first stage) and spiral-bevel gears (for the right-angle stage) ensures that gear teeth engage gradually. This results in:
- Lower acoustic noise levels.
- Reduced vibration, which protects the bearings of both the motor and the driven machine.
- Superior resistance to high shock loads.
Hollow Shaft with Shrink Disk (H)
The hollow shaft design is a major maintenance advantage. By using a shrink disk (a keyless friction connection), the gearbox is clamped onto the driven shaft. This eliminates the "fretting corrosion" common with keyed shafts, making it much easier to remove the gearbox for servicing after years of use.
3. Essential Manual & Maintenance Highlights
According to the SEW-EURODRIVE Industrial Gear Units: MC Series manual, following a strict maintenance schedule is critical for the "03" frame size.
Lubrication Management
- Oil Selection: Use only approved lubricants (Mineral CLP or Synthetic CLP HC/PAO). Synthetic oil is highly recommended for high-temperature environments to prevent oxidation.
- Oil Changes: Mineral oil should generally be changed every 10,000 operating hours or 2 years. Synthetic oil can often last up to 20,000 hours or 4 years.
- Visual Checks: Regularly inspect the oil level via the sight glass and check the magnetic screw for metal particles, which could indicate internal wear.
Thermal Monitoring
The MC2RLHF03 can generate significant heat under full load. The manual specifies:
- Ventilation: Ensure the breather valve is not clogged. A blocked breather can cause internal pressure to rise, leading to oil leaks at the shaft seals.
- Cooling: If the unit is equipped with a shaft-driven fan or cooling coils, these must be inspected for debris buildup to ensure optimal heat dissipation.
Sealing Systems
For dusty or abrasive environments (common in Korea's heavy industries), the manual recommends the use of Taconite seals or Dust-proof labyrinth seals to prevent contaminants from entering the gear chamber and destroying the precision-ground teeth.
4. Typical Applications
The MC2RLHF03 is a "workhorse" in sectors requiring right-angle drives:
- Belt Conveyors: Where the motor must be tucked alongside the conveyor belt to save walkway space.
- Agitators and Mixers: Using the flange (F) mount for stable, overhead mounting on chemical or food processing tanks.
- Bucket Elevators: Providing the high torque needed for vertical material transport.
